<h2>Coleraine Face Crisis-Hit Glenavon in Lopsided Lurgan Showdown</h2> <p>Friday afternoon's encounter at Mourneview Park represents a tale of two contrasting starts to the Northern Ireland Premiership season, with second-placed <strong>Coleraine</strong> traveling to face basement dwellers <strong>Glenavon</strong> in what promises to be one of the most statistically lopsided fixtures of the early campaign.</p> <h3>The Crisis at Mourneview Park</h3> <p>Glenavon's start to the 2025-26 season has been nothing short of catastrophic. Three matches have yielded zero points, zero goals scored, and five goals conceded - a statistical combination that speaks to fundamental issues throughout the squad. The <strong>2-0 home defeat to Ballymena United</strong> on August 9th set the tone, followed by equally dispiriting losses at Carrick Rangers (1-0) and Glentoran (2-0). Most concerning is the complete absence of attacking threat, with the Lurgan-based club failing to register on the scoresheet across 270 minutes of football.</p> <p>Manager's tactical approach has come under scrutiny, particularly the defensive structure that has seen goals conceded in crucial periods - three of their five goals shipped have come between the 31st and 45th minutes, suggesting concentration lapses before half-time. The psychological impact of this winless run cannot be understated, especially with vocal home support growing increasingly restless.</p> <h3>Coleraine's Impressive Early Form</h3> <p>In stark contrast, Coleraine has begun the campaign with impressive defensive solidity and tactical discipline. Their <strong>perfect clean sheet record</strong> across three matches - including wins over Larne (1-0) and Dungannon (2-0), plus a creditable goalless draw away at Cliftonville - demonstrates the foundation Oran Kearney has built.</p> <p>The Bannsiders' approach has been methodical rather than spectacular, with <strong>Joel Cooper's 86th-minute winner against Larne</strong> and <strong>Declan McManus and Jamie Glackin's first-half double against Dungannon</strong> showcasing both patience and clinical finishing when opportunities arise. Their average scoring time of 56 minutes suggests a team comfortable building pressure throughout matches rather than relying on early strikes.</p> <h3>Historical Context and Pre-Season Intelligence</h3> <p>While historical head-to-head records show relative parity over 40 previous meetings (Glenavon 14 wins, Coleraine 10 wins, 16 draws), recent encounters have favored the visitors. Most significantly, <strong>Coleraine's emphatic 4-0 victory over Glenavon in July's pre-season friendly</strong> highlighted the gulf in current form and confidence levels between these sides.</p> <p>The broader context of both clubs' summer preparations adds weight to current form indicators.
